Following up Seeker's Armguard is its upgrade, Zhonya's Hourglass. Stopwatch is included here as well since every class of character can make use of the item. Stopwatch, on its own, gives absolutely no stats at a cost of 600 gold. The rune "Perfect Timing" also grants the player a free Stopwatch after a period of time. The first day will feature five rounds, and will narrow down the 24 competitors down to 16. Lobbies will be determined by players' performances in their regional qualifiers. The second day will also feature five rounds, narrowing down the competitors from 16 to 8. The third and final day will feature rounds where players race to earn the most points . Chemtech Putrifier is just that item. Its passive, Puffcap Toxin, empowers allies on healing and shielding effects with the ability to inflict Grievous Wounds. Enchanters, particularly those with a Moonstone Renewer, will be able to apply this passive multiple times in an extended fight, guaranteeing Grievous Wound uptime.
